Dog Stretched Into Yoga Pose Has Internet in Stitches

A video of a dog being stretched into a yoga pose by a man has gone viral online, and it is easy to see why.

In the funny footage, shared to TikTok by an account called Dendollas, we can see a small sandy-colored pooch standing facing a man who is sitting on a sofa.

The man then gently lifts the pet's hindlegs until the animal is performing a handstand, and then begins cheering and patting the dog's stomach.

Following this, the dog is lowered back to the floor and sits down in apparent expectation of trying the move again.

The adorable footage, which can be watched here, is captioned: "How my dad stretches our dog #fyp #dog."

The clip has gained lots of traction online since it was shared on January 11, having attracted more than 25.3 million views and 4.6 million likes.

Additionally, it was also reposted onto popular Instagram meme page Pubity, where it has surpassed a staggering 502,200 likes, as well as a TikTok account called Betch, where it has garnered a further 171,400 likes.
